- 1、本文档共94页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第章__TMSCx的CPU结构和存储器配置.ppt
图2-12 TMS320C5402存储器图 2.4.2 程序存储器 TMS320C54x可以寻址64 K字的程序存储空间。(TMS320C548、TMS320C549、TMS320C5410、TMS320C5402和TMS320C5420可以扩展到8 MW。) TMS320C54x的片内ROM、片内双寻址DARAM和片内单寻址SARAM都可以通过软件配置到程序存储空间中。如果片内存储器配置到程序存储器中,则芯片在访问程序存储器时会自动访问这些存储单元。当PAGEN产生了一个不在片内存储器的地址时,会自动使用一个外部总线操作。 下表是TMS320C54x系列芯片的片内程序存储器配置。 TSM320C54x芯片片内程序存储器配置 (单位:K字) 1.程序存储器配置 MP/ 和OVLY位决定片内存储器是否配置到程序存储空间。复位时,MP/ 引脚上的逻辑电平将设置PMST寄存器的MP/MC位。MP/ 引脚在复位时有效。复位后,PMST寄存器的MP/ 位决定芯片的工作方式,直到下一次复位。 下面以TMS320C541芯片为例,介绍TMS320C54x器件的地址映像与程序存储器的分配。 下图给出了在两种情况下,两个控制位对程序存储器配置的影响。 图2-13 TMS320C541程序存储器配置图 当MP/ =1,OVLY=0时,TMS320C541工作在微处理器模式下,片内ROM、片内DARAM不安排到程序存储空间。 当MP/ =0,OVLY=1时,TMS320C541工作在微型计算机模式下,片内28 K字ROM(9000H~FF7FH)、片内复位和中断向量(FF80H~FFFFH)可作为程序存储器;片内5 K字DARAM可作为程序存储器。 2.片内ROM的组织 为了提高芯片的性能,对片内的ROM按照块的方式组织,如图2-6所示。这样,可以在一个块中取指的同时不会影响在另一个块中读取操作数。 图2-6 TMS320C54x的片内ROM的分块图 3.片内ROM在程序存储空间中的地址配置 注意1:当芯片复位时,复位、中断向量分配在由FF80H开始的程序存储空间中,然而,TMS320C54x的中断矢量表可以重定位到任意一个128字的边界上去,这就很容易将中断矢量表从引导ROM中移出来,然后再根据存储器图安排。 注意2:在片内ROM中,有128个字用于保存检测设备的目的,应用程序不要写到这段存储器中(FF00H~FF7FH)。 4.片内ROM的内容和配置 TMS320C54x的片内ROM的容量有大有小,大的ROM(24 K、28 K或48 K字)可把用户的程序代码写进去;小的ROM(高2K字)由TI公司定义。根据不同的型号,TMS320C54x的2 K字程序空间中包含以下内容: ● 自举加载程序:完成串行口、外部存储器、I/O口或并行口BOOT-LOAD功能的程序代码; ● 256字的μ率扩展表; ● 256字的A率扩展表; ● 256字的正弦表; ● 中断向量表。 图2-7是片内ROM中包含上述各种内容的总结。当MP/ =0时,FF80H~FFFFH配置成片内ROM。 图2-7 片内ROM程序存储器图 5.扩展程序存储器(不讲) TMS320C548/549/5402/5410/5420采用分页技术,可以将程序存储空间扩展为8 M字。因此,这些芯片提供了一些增强的特性: ● 23条地址线(TMS320C5402有18条地址线,TMS320C5420有18条地址线); ● 额外的存储器映像寄存器、程序计数器扩展寄存器(XPC); ● 6条额外的指令用于寻址扩展的程序存储空间,改变XPC的值。它们是: FB[D]:远跳转。 FBACC[D]:远跳转到累加器A或B指定的地址。 FCALA[D]:远调用累加器A或B指定的子程序。 FCALL[D]:远调用。 FRET[D]:远返回。 FRETE[D]:远返回且中断允许。
您可能关注的文档
- 让你过目不忘的ppt文档.ppt
- 国际金融事务chapter1.ppt
- 公司法与商法_Part_A_-_China's_legal_system.ppt
- XXXX余热回收介绍.ppt
- 第章_计算机基本知识.ppt
- 德江县年党政机关公文格式培训().ppt
- 第二周Protel介绍.ppt
- 动漫店创业分析与动漫风险提示.ppt
- _第三章_砌筑工程.ppt
- 第章:嵌入式系统硬件设计.ppt
- 2025年湖北省黄冈市单招(语文)测试模拟题库及答案1套.docx
- 2025年湖南体育职业学院单招(语文)测试题库及参考答案一套.docx
- 2025年湖南中医药高等专科学校单招语文测试模拟题库及完整答案一套.docx
- 2025年湖北黄冈应急管理职业技术学院单招(语文)测试题库含答案.docx
- 2025年湖北省襄樊市选调生考试(公共基础知识)综合能力测试题学生专用.docx
- 2025年湖南机电职业技术学院单招语文测试模拟题库必考题.docx
- 2025年湖北省黄石市事业单位招聘考试(职业能力倾向测验)题库推荐.docx
- 2025年湖南交通职业技术学院单招语文测试题库必威体育精装版.docx
- 2025年湖北职业技术学院单招(语文)测试题库有答案.docx
- 2025年湖南信息职业技术学院单招(语文)测试模拟题库参考答案.docx
文档评论(0)